Size: a a a

Angular - русскоговорящее сообщество

2019 September 18

АК

Алексей Компанец in Angular - русскоговорящее сообщество
На 76 все работало без ошибок
источник

RK

Roman Kolesnikov in Angular - русскоговорящее сообщество
Алексей Компанец
Нет. Он и так пустой. А даже если и не пустой, то значения должны перезаписаться
очисти вручную и попробуй запустить тесты
источник

RK

Roman Kolesnikov in Angular - русскоговорящее сообщество
источник

RK

Roman Kolesnikov in Angular - русскоговорящее сообщество
или сразу через
источник

АК

Алексей Компанец in Angular - русскоговорящее сообщество
))) Тесты запускаются в отдельном экземпляре Chrome.
источник

АК

Алексей Компанец in Angular - русскоговорящее сообщество
У него свои базы
источник

🧤K

🧤 Andrei Kapytau in Angular - русскоговорящее сообщество
Andrew Yakovlev
Является ли бэд практикс вызов detectChanges()  вручную?
Вообще да ) речь о детектчейнджс, не маркыорчек)
источник

VG

Vladislav Golovatyi in Angular - русскоговорящее сообщество
Roman Kolesnikov
если я правильно понял, логика на бэке не до конца реализована
если нужно сейчас, то просто очисти куки при логауте на фронте
подключил куки от ngx. Удаляю таким образом
 this.cookieService.deleteAll();
но куки все равно остаются. Может что-то еще нужно?
источник

RK

Roman Kolesnikov in Angular - русскоговорящее сообщество
Vladislav Golovatyi
подключил куки от ngx. Удаляю таким образом
 this.cookieService.deleteAll();
но куки все равно остаются. Может что-то еще нужно?
так не получится, если мы говорим о локалхосте
источник

VG

Vladislav Golovatyi in Angular - русскоговорящее сообщество
Roman Kolesnikov
так не получится, если мы говорим о локалхосте
да, локалхост
источник

VG

Vladislav Golovatyi in Angular - русскоговорящее сообщество
а как тогда?)
источник

RK

Roman Kolesnikov in Angular - русскоговорящее сообщество
this.cookieService.delete('JWT_TOKEN', environment.path, environment.domain);
-
path: null,
domain: null,
источник

VG

Vladislav Golovatyi in Angular - русскоговорящее сообщество
Roman Kolesnikov
this.cookieService.delete('JWT_TOKEN', environment.path, environment.domain);
-
path: null,
domain: null,
источник

RK

Roman Kolesnikov in Angular - русскоговорящее сообщество
this.cookieService.delete('JWT_TOKEN', null, null); - так делал? у тебя в environment врядли это прописано
источник

VG

Vladislav Golovatyi in Angular - русскоговорящее сообщество
Roman Kolesnikov
this.cookieService.delete('JWT_TOKEN', null, null); - так делал? у тебя в environment врядли это прописано
а, теперь понял
источник

VG

Vladislav Golovatyi in Angular - русскоговорящее сообщество
сейчас попробую
источник

VG

Vladislav Golovatyi in Angular - русскоговорящее сообщество
Roman Kolesnikov
this.cookieService.delete('JWT_TOKEN', null, null); - так делал? у тебя в environment врядли это прописано
Сделал так. После логаута у меня стоит navigate на /login маппинг. Но все равно JSESSIONID остается в куках
источник

RK

Roman Kolesnikov in Angular - русскоговорящее сообщество
Vladislav Golovatyi
Сделал так. После логаута у меня стоит navigate на /login маппинг. Но все равно JSESSIONID остается в куках
JWT_TOKEN заменил на JSESSIONID?
источник

VG

Vladislav Golovatyi in Angular - русскоговорящее сообщество
да
источник

RK

Roman Kolesnikov in Angular - русскоговорящее сообщество
замени запись на this.cookieService.set('JSESSIONID', token (твой токен), 365, null);
потом удали все с куков и попробуй еще раз этот сценарий
источник